Define enum `eContextResult` and use its values for returns, instead of
just returning 1, 0, or -1 (and always having some comment that explains
what -1 means).
This also cleans up the mixup between returning `0` and `false`, and `1`
and `true`. An inconsistency was discovered during this cleanup, and
marked with `TODO(sybren)`. It's not fixed here, as it would consititute
a functional change.
The enum isn't used everywhere, as enums in C and C++ can have different
storage sizes. To prevent issues, callback functions are still declared
as returning`int`. To at least make things easier to understand for
humans, I marked those with `int /*eContextResult*/`.
This is a followup of D9090, and is intended to unify how context
callbacks return values. This will make it easier to extend the approach
in D9090 to those functions.
No functional changes.
Differential Revision: https://developer.blender.org/D9095

.blend file.
Relying on pointer addresses across different data-blocks is extremely
not recommended (and should be strictly forbidden ideally), in
particular in direct_link step of blend file reading.
- It assumes a specific order in reading of data, which is not ensured
in future, and is in any case a very bad, non explicit, hidden
dependency on behaviors of other parts of the codebase.
- It is intrinsically unsafe (as in, it makes writing bad code and making
mistakes easy, see e.g. fix in rB84b3f6e049b35f9).
- It makes advanced handling of data-blocks harder (thinking about
partial undo code e.g., even though in this specific case it was not
an issue as we do not re-read neither windowmanagers nor worspaces
during undo).
New code uses windows' `winid` instead as 'anchor' to find again proper
workspace hook in windows at read time.
As a bonus, it will also cleanup the list of relations from any invalid
ones (afaict it was never done previously).
Differential Revision: https://developer.blender.org/D9073

This adds a search bar to the properties editor. The full search for
every tab isn't included in this patch, but the interaction with
panels, searching behavior, UI, region level, and DNA changes are
included here.
The block-level search works by iterating over the block's button
groups and checking whether they match the search. If they do, they
are tagged with a flag, and the block's panel is tagged too. For
every update (text edit), the panel's expansion is set to whether
the panel has a result or not. The search also checks for matching
strings inside enums and in panel labels.
One complication to this that isn't immediately apparent is that
closed panel's subpanels have to be searched too. This adds some
complexity to the area-level panel layout code.
Possible Future Improvements:
- Use the new fuzzy search in BLI
- Reset panels to their expansion before the search started if
the user escape out of the text box.
- Open all child panels of a panel with expansion.
Differential Revision: https://developer.blender.org/D8856

The issue was that the screen geometry calculations scaled down the
areas, but the header would become too small. So it would be upscaled
again towards the lower screen edge (where the status-bar is at). Now we
do another pass over the geometry calculations, until all areas fit into
the screen, or until some rather arbitrary maximum is reached.
This fixes the issue for common cases. Extreme cases, with many
vertically stashed editors and a too small window to show all, are still
not too well supported. Blender keeps working but the status-bar is
still overlapped. We could deal with this better but what's there now
should be good enough.
